SIGI Hedge Fund Activity: Q4 2014 in Review

176 of the 3,750 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Selective Insurance (SIGI) for Q4 2014, worth a combined $1.12B — up 21% from $924M a quarter earlier.

Buyers outnumbered sellers: 25 funds opened new SIGI positions and 8 closed out — a net gain of 17 holders — while 73 added to existing stakes and 55 trimmed.

The largest buyer was BlackRock Fund Advisors, adding an estimated $8.79M. The largest seller was Columbia Wanger Asset Management, cutting an estimated $49M.
